The ingredients needed to make Garlic Rosemary Pan Baked Chicken:
  1. Take 4 Chicken Skinless Boneless Chicken Breast
  2. Make ready 2 tbsp Olive Oil
  3. Prepare 1 Salt
  4. Prepare 1 Pepper
  5. Prepare 5 clove Garlic Finely Chopped
  6. Get 1 tbsp Dried Rosemary Leaves
Instructions to make Garlic Rosemary Pan Baked Chicken:
  1. Heat Oven to 375°F
  2. Brush the bottom of a 10-12 inch cast iron skillet with olive oil
  3. Place chicken in pan. Salt and Pepper to taste
  4. Place skillet on bottom rack in hot oven and bake for 15 minutes
  5. Meanwhile,melt butter in a small saucepan over medium heat.
  6. After butter is melted add garlic and rosemary cook 3-5 minutes,stirring occasionally until fragrant. Removed from heat
  7. After baking chicken for 15 minutes remove and pour butter mixture over top chicken. Put back in oven 20 more minutes longer or until chicken is no longer pink.
  8. Plate and enjoy
